Former French colonies Compared by Industry > Manufacturing output

DEFINITION: Industry corresponds to ISIC divisions 10-45 and includes manufacturing (ISIC divisions 15-37). It comprises value added in mining, manufacturing (also reported as a separate subgroup), construction, electricity, water, and gas. Value added is the net output of a sector after adding up all outputs and subtracting intermediate inputs. It is calculated without making deductions for depreciation of fabricated assets or depletion and degradation of natural resources. The origin of value added is determined by the International Standard Industrial Classification (ISIC), revision 3. Data are in constant 2000 U.S. dollars.".

# COUNTRY AMOUNT DATE GRAPH HISTORY
1 Algeria 39.57 billion 2009
2 Vietnam 25.38 billion 2009
3 Morocco 13.31 billion 2009
4 Syria 8.61 billion 2009
5 Tunisia 7.74 billion 2009
6 Lebanon 5.05 billion 2009
7 Cameroon 3.46 billion 2007
8 Gabon 3.04 billion 2009
9 Cote d'Ivoire 2.54 billion 2009
10 Mozambique 2.07 billion 2009
11 Cambodia 2.04 billion 2009
12 Guinea 1.43 billion 2009
13 Senegal 1.3 billion 2009
14 Laos 918.85 million 2008
15 Burkina Faso 852.96 million 2006
16 Chad 834.58 million 2004
17 Madagascar 717.42 million 2009
18 Mali 699.6 million 2007
19 Benin 386.51 million 2005
20 Mauritania 375.37 million 2007
21 Niger 350.17 million 2003
22 Togo 332.47 million 2005
23 Central African Republic 146.21 million 2006
24 Djibouti 97.77 million 2006
